What does SBIN0020864 mean?
SBIN0020864
SBIN — Bank code. Identifies State Bank of India. All branches of State Bank of India share this prefix.
0 — Reserved character. Always zero in every IFSC code in India.
020864 — Branch code. Uniquely identifies the SAROORNAGAR HYDERABAD branch within State Bank of India.
